Key Highlights: Online Master of Business Administration in Information Technology

Slide 1 of 1

Total fees: ₹1,60,000

Recognised & accredited: UGC, AICTE

Minimum Eligibility: Graduation from recognized University

NIRF Ranking: 59

Course Duration: 2 years

Address: Pune, Maharashtra, India

Benefits of an Online MBA in Information Technology from Bharati Vidyapeeth University

Each benefit reflects real-world application and focuses on building your capability in both IT and management.

Here’s what you unlock with this degree:

  • Master Systems and SDLC: You’ll understand system types, life cycles, and structured analysis. This helps you oversee projects efficiently, identify bottlenecks, and improve workflows.
  • Design Databases and Interfaces: You’ll create ER diagrams, flowcharts, and user interfaces. These tools make systems easier to use and data easier to manage, saving time and reducing errors.
  • Audit and Control Skills: You’ll learn audit techniques, internal controls, and risk evaluation. You can spot weaknesses in systems and ensure they meet organizational and regulatory standards.
  • Cybersecurity Awareness: You’ll explore threats, attack types, and fraud methods. You’ll learn how to design policies and practices that protect your organization’s data.
  • Plan for Risks and Continuity: You’ll develop skills to identify risks and implement disaster recovery and business continuity plans. You’ll know how to keep operations running under pressure.
  • Stay Ahead with Emerging Tech: You’ll gain insights into cloud computing, mobile platforms, BYOD risks, and social media security. You’ll understand what new technologies mean for your business and how to use them safely.
  • Hands-on Case Studies: You’ll apply learning to hospital, hotel, library, and inventory management systems. You can test ideas, make decisions, and see how your solutions would work in the real world.
  • Measure Performance Effectively: You’ll learn to evaluate system quality, data integrity, and organizational impact. You’ll be able to make data-driven recommendations with confidence.
  • Flexible Learning with Support: You can pace your learning around your work schedule. Faculty will guide you through complex topics, helping you turn theory into practical skills you can use immediately.
